Full Description

(TR3385577) Iron Age coin dated c 50-40 BC of the Ambiani, Viricius. It was discovered by metal detection near Sandwich in 1985. Coin reference no. TWRA-TYMAR-IA-31. It is made of AE, measures 13.75-14.5 mm in diameter and weighs 2.40 gm. The obverse side has a Celticized head left, to right. The reverse has a Celticized horse galloping left, ring below, VIRICIVS above. It is part of the Scheers series 109, class 1 ( cf plate 454). The coin is in very good condition. It was possibly minted at Bois L'Abbe, Eu. (1)
